Transaction 86af69c5bd5661c0f355a0098084a834bd68cef0ceda7fe2ef9f0a0cf84487f8
1 Input
1 Output
-
86af69c5bd5661c0f355a0098084a834bd68cef0ceda7fe2ef9f0a0cf84487f8:0
- value
- 43882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b03257612cdc8c81b70e58cd310dedcd7d638355 OP_EQUAL
- address
- 3HkfA5k6ucfPsCGAH2Uim1qNTbdsagPTgo